
2005 200 MONGES GRAN RESERVA BY BODEGAS VINICOLA REAL, RIOJA SPAIN
Name and Region
-
Wine: 2005 200 Monges Gran Reserva
-
Winery: Bodegas Vinícola Real
-
Region: Rioja DOCa, specifically from the Rioja Baja - Oriental subregion
Blend/Varietal
-
Grapes: Tempranillo, Garnacha, and Graciano
Tasting Notes
-
Appearance: Deep cherry red with a garnet rim
-
Nose: Aromas of ripe fruit, dried fruit, aged wood nuances, cocoa bean, and fine reductive notes
-
Palate: Good structure, balanced acidity, slightly overripe flavors, and powerful tannins

Winemaker Notes
The 2005 vintage represents the pinnacle of the 200 Monges concept, showcasing the winery's commitment to quality and tradition. The blend of Tempranillo, Garnacha, and Graciano grapes provides a harmonious balance of freshness, structure, and acidity, contributing to the wine's longevity and elegance. The extended aging process in oak barrels and subsequent bottle rest enhances the wine's complexity and character .
Food Pairing
This Gran Reserva pairs excellently with dishes such as lamb, particularly milk-fed lamb, which complements the wine's rich and complex flavors
